Vacuum energy. Vacuum energy is an underlying background energy that exists in space throughout the entire Universe.

Vacuum energy

One contribution to the vacuum energy may be from virtual particles which are thought to be particle pairs that blink into existence and then annihilate in a timespan too short to observe. Quantum field theory in curved spacetime. In particle physics, quantum field theory in curved spacetime is an extension of standard, Minkowski-space quantum field theory to curved spacetime.

Quantum field theory in curved spacetime

A general prediction of this theory is that particles can be created by time-dependent gravitational fields (multigraviton pair production), or by time-independent gravitational fields that contain horizons. Description[edit] Virtual particle. In physics, a virtual particle is a transient fluctuation that exhibits many of the characteristics of an ordinary particle, but that exists for a limited time.

Virtual particle

The concept of virtual particles arises in perturbation theory of quantum field theory where interactions between ordinary particles are described in terms of exchanges of virtual particles. Any process involving virtual particles admits a schematic representation known as a Feynman diagram, in which virtual particles are represented by internal lines. [1][2] Virtual particles do not necessarily carry the same mass as the corresponding real particle, although they always conserve energy and momentum.

The longer the virtual particle exists, the closer its characteristics come to those of ordinary particles. They are important in the physics of many processes, including particle scattering and Casimir forces. Antiparticles have been proven to exist and should not be confused with virtual particles or virtual antiparticles. Nothing helps create pure randomness › News in Science (ABC Science) News in Science Monday, 16 April 2012 Darren OsborneABC Counting on nothing Quantum fluctuations within a vacuum are helping Australian researchers create billions of random numbers.

Nothing helps create pure randomness › News in Science (ABC Science)

The random number generator, created by Professor Ping Koy Lam, Dr Thomas Symul and Dr Syed Assad from the Australian National University (ANU), uses highly sensitive light detectors to 'listen' to an empty space. Until recently a vacuum was thought to be completely empty. But modern quantum theory now suggests that it is filled with virtual sub-atomic particles spontaneously appearing and disappearing, creating random noise. This 'vacuum noise' may affect, and ultimately pose a limit to, the performance of fibre optic communication, radio broadcasts and computer operation. Friday, April 11, 2014 Reliable and unbiased random numbers are needed for a range of applications spanning from numerical modeling to cryptographic communications. While there are algorithms that can generate pseudo random numbers, they can never be perfectly random nor indeterministic. Researchers at the ANU are generating true random numbers from a physical quantum source. ANU Quantum Random Number Server. This website offers true random numbers to anyone on the internet. The random numbers are generated in real-time in our lab by measuring the quantum fluctuations of the vacuum. The vacuum is described very differently in the quantum mechanical context than in the classical context.

Traditionally, a vacuum is considered as a space that is empty of matter or photons. Quantum mechanically, however, that same space resembles a sea of virtual particles appearing and disappearing all the time. The Ultimate Question of Origins: God and the Beginning of the Universe.
